Robert Malin's world with SO15 Counter Terrorist Command ended under the surgeon's scalpel having a brain tumour removed. Until the moment Hans Jacob, a wealthy German industrialist offered him the sum of £250,000 to recover a cross made from six bones of victims of the holocaust at Auschwitz. A sharp-minded and cynical maverick, to recover the bones Malin covers four continents, trapped in a mosaic of treachery created by neo-Nazis. But what secret does the cross holds? Why does he have to turn into a cold-blooded killer to survive and recover the bones? And why are the Russians and MI5 interested in his movements?
